Ministry Leadership Development

 
Ministry Leadership Development (MLD) is the part of the Master of Divinity degree curriculum wherein students receive training for leadership in vocational ministry capacities through courses in ministry practice and educational experiences within supervised ministry settings. The purpose of MLD is to work in concert with other courses in the divinity school curriculum to prepare God-called persons for service in the Church of Jesus Christ. MLD seeks to advance the growth of students toward: spiritual maturity, vocational clarification and ministry competence.
